Abstract
In one aspect, the present disclosure relates to a method to read energy-related data in a power meter. In one exemplary embodiment, the method includes the step of sending a request message to an on-premise processor, directing the on-premise processor to read energy-related data from a power meter, using an 802.11 X-based wireless protocol. The method further includes the step of retrieving energy-related data stored in a memory of the power meter by the on-premise processor, using the 802.11 X-based wireless protocol, and the step of receiving a response message sent at a host processor, communicated from the on-premise processor, using the 802.11 X wireless protocol. The method further includes the step of recording the energy related data in a data structure in memory of the host processor, along with a date and time information.

43. A method to read energy related data in a power meter comprising:
-
sending a request message to an on-premise processor directing the on-premise processor to read energy related data from a power meter identified by a meter identification number using an 802.11X-based wireless protocol; retrieving energy related data stored in a memory of the power meter by the on-premise processor using the 802.11X-based wireless protocol and the meter identification number; receiving a response message sent at a host processor communicated from the on-premise processor using the 802.11X wireless protocol indicating the energy related data and the meter identification number; and recording the energy related data associated with the meter identification number in a data structure in memory of the host processor along with a date and time information. - View Dependent Claims (44, 45)

46. A method for reading data from a utility meter, comprising:
-
storing a utility meter address and a utility meter reading schedule in an on-premise processor indicating a time to read data from at least one utility meter; communicating a meter reading request message incorporating the utility meter address from the on-premise processor to the utility meter using an 802.1 1X wireless protocol at a time indicated by the meter reading schedule; receiving a meter reading response message at the on-premise processor containing usage related data communicated using the 802.1 1X wireless protocol; and sending a meter reading report message from the on-premise processor to a host processor, the meter reading report message including usage data, meter type, and the utility meter address. - View Dependent Claims (47)

48. A method for a host processor to read measurement data from a utility meter, comprising the steps of:
-
receiving a first request message at the on-premise processor sent from the host processor requesting measurement data from an utility meter wherein the request includes a meter identifier associated with the utility meter; sending a first acknowledgment message in response to the first request by the on-premise processor to the host processor indicating error free receipt of the first request; sending a second request message from the on-premise processor to the utility meter communicated using a 802.11X wireless protocol requesting measurement data from the utility meter; receiving a first response message at the on-premise processor from the utility meter communicated using the 802.11X wireless protocol including the measurement data and a date; sending a second acknowledgement message from the on-premise processor to the host processor including the measurement data and the date; and recording the measurement data and the date in a data structure associated with the meter identifier in the host processor. - View Dependent Claims (49)

50. A method for a host processor to obtain measurement data from a utility meter, comprising:
-
receiving periodic measurement data at the on-premise processor from the utility meter communicated using an 802.11X wireless protocol containing a utility meter identification number; storing the measurement data and the identification number in a memory in an on-premise processor along with time-related data; receiving a first request message at the on-premise processor from the host processor requesting the measurement data for the utility meter, the first request message including the utility meter identification number; retrieving the measurement data and the time-related data in the memory of the on-premise processor associated with the utility meter identification number; and sending a reporting message from the on-premise processor to the host processor incorporating the measurement data, the utility meter identification number, and the time-related data. - View Dependent Claims (51)
